**Ticket PLV-armory: Vault locked, can't update autocomplete config**

The Hollowgate vault holding the Addrly autocomplete widget's region dataset keys auto-locked after three failed attempts (oops, stale creds in my shell history). Rotation is blocked until someone reopens it. Future maintainers: don't cache vault creds locally, learn from me. Per the recovery runbook, the vault reopens with the passphrase below.

unlock words, yawig-kagef: gordor-holvan-ulaael-pramir-ulaiel-tamdor

## Break-Glass: Tilegrab Prefetcher

Tilegrab prefetches map tiles for the Norrow courier fleet. If it wedges and the cache goes stale, couriers lose offline routing fast. Normal restarts go through the Pellman deploy queue — don't bypass it unless the queue itself is down. Break-glass gives direct shell on the prefetcher primary for fifteen minutes, fully audited. Page the duty lead first, then log your reason. To open the session, enter the recovery passphrase below.

strongbox words: praath-queniel-holax-druael-jorath-noveth-druok

## Action Item PM-41: Offline mode hardening (Tallgrass Survey)

Owner: contractor onboarding this sprint. During the Millbrook outage, field crews lost two days of plot data because the sync queue silently dropped entries past its cap. Fix: persist the queue to disk, add exponential backoff on reconnect, and surface queue depth in the app header. Don't guess at limits — the values below were agreed in the incident review. Apply these constants exactly.

constants for fajop-tahaf:
RATE_LIMITS = {
    "holael": 2,
    "oliael": 10,
    "druael": 10,
    "wenwyn": 10,
}

Hello Brightfoyer integration team,

As discussed, the Stageglow seat-map renderer for the Orpheline Theatre goes live next Monday. Support staff should know that seat availability refreshes every 15 seconds, so brief discrepancies during high-demand on-sales are expected and not a defect. Accessibility seats render with a distinct outline; if they appear unstyled, the venue config likely failed to load. When verifying the config endpoint manually, authenticate your request with the token below.

portal login ticket: eyJhbGciOiJIUzI1NiIsInR5cCI6IkpXVCJ9.eyJzdWIiOiIYVgTyo3M-MIn0.PRnVS6uMEYGo